To create a new Key-Point File
First enter a filename :
Ö Click in the
Filename to be sent to Gauge
box, then enter a name of up to 8
characters, made up of numbers and letters.
Now set the Measurement Units :
Ö click on the desired button for the
Measurement Units
CygLink will automatically switch to measure in these units when this file is in use
Ö Click on the Create New button :
The
Add a Key-Point Record
dialog will become active, and you can now begin
adding a series of Key-Point Records
To open an existing Key-Point File
An existing Key-Point file can be used as a template to create new files, or it can be re-
opened to continue a previous editing session :
Ö Click on the Open Existing button
The Open Key-Point File dialog window will open :
Ö Navigate to the Directory where the existing file was saved, then click on the filename
Ö Click the Open button to re-open the file
The file will open, and its values will be copied into the boxes in the Edit Key-Point
Record-list window
Creating a Key-Point file
¾ A Key-Point file consists of a set of Key-Point Records, and each file can contain up to
999 Records
¾ Each Key-Point Record has an individual set of values : a Name and a specified
minimum number of required Readings, and an optional Reference Thickness plus
UpperTolerance and Lower Tolerance figures
¾ New Records can be added to the end of the list of Records
¾ The contents of each Record in the list can be edited
¾ Records can be cut, copied and pasted within the list, and the order of the Records in the
list can be changed
Create a new file by entering a series of Key-Point Records :
¾ In a new file : the
Total Records
box will initially show zero Records added so far
¾
Next Record
box will initially show Record number 1, as the next Record to be added
¾ Both counters will increase each time the
Add
button is pressed
